OpenSim.Region.ClientStack.LindenUDP.LLUDPServer.SendPacketFinal C# (CSharp) Method

SendPacketFinal() private method

Actually send a packet to a client.
private SendPacketFinal ( OutgoingPacket outgoingPacket ) : void
outgoingPacket OutgoingPacket
return void
        internal void SendPacketFinal(OutgoingPacket outgoingPacket)
        {
            UDPPacketBuffer buffer = outgoingPacket.Buffer;
            byte flags = buffer.Data[0];
            bool isResend = (flags & Helpers.MSG_RESENT) != 0;
            bool isReliable = (flags & Helpers.MSG_RELIABLE) != 0;
            bool isZerocoded = (flags & Helpers.MSG_ZEROCODED) != 0;
            LLUDPClient udpClient = outgoingPacket.Client;

            if (!udpClient.IsConnected)
                return;

            #region ACK Appending

            int dataLength = buffer.DataLength;

            // NOTE: I'm seeing problems with some viewers when ACKs are appended to zerocoded packets so I've disabled that here
            if (!isZerocoded)
            {
                // Keep appending ACKs until there is no room left in the buffer or there are
                // no more ACKs to append
                uint ackCount = 0;
                uint ack;
                while (dataLength + 5 < buffer.Data.Length && udpClient.PendingAcks.Dequeue(out ack))
                {
                    Utils.UIntToBytesBig(ack, buffer.Data, dataLength);
                    dataLength += 4;
                    ++ackCount;
                }

                if (ackCount > 0)
                {
                    // Set the last byte of the packet equal to the number of appended ACKs
                    buffer.Data[dataLength++] = (byte)ackCount;
                    // Set the appended ACKs flag on this packet
                    buffer.Data[0] = (byte)(buffer.Data[0] | Helpers.MSG_APPENDED_ACKS);
                }
            }

            buffer.DataLength = dataLength;

            #endregion ACK Appending

            #region Sequence Number Assignment

            if (!isResend)
            {
                // Not a resend, assign a new sequence number
                uint sequenceNumber = (uint)Interlocked.Increment(ref udpClient.CurrentSequence);
                Utils.UIntToBytesBig(sequenceNumber, buffer.Data, 1);
                outgoingPacket.SequenceNumber = sequenceNumber;

                if (isReliable)
                {
                    // Add this packet to the list of ACK responses we are waiting on from the server
                    udpClient.NeedAcks.Add(outgoingPacket);
                }
            }

            #endregion Sequence Number Assignment

            // Stats tracking
            Interlocked.Increment(ref udpClient.PacketsSent);
            if (isReliable)
                Interlocked.Add(ref udpClient.UnackedBytes, outgoingPacket.Buffer.DataLength);

            // Put the UDP payload on the wire
            AsyncBeginSend(buffer);

            // Keep track of when this packet was sent out (right now)
            outgoingPacket.TickCount = Environment.TickCount & Int32.MaxValue;
        }

Usage Example

        /// <summary>
        /// Loops through all of the packet queues for this client and tries to send
        /// an outgoing packet from each, obeying the throttling bucket limits
        /// </summary>
        ///
        /// <remarks>
        /// Packet queues are inspected in ascending numerical order starting from 0.  Therefore, queues with a lower
        /// ThrottleOutPacketType number will see their packet get sent first (e.g. if both Land and Wind queues have
        /// packets, then the packet at the front of the Land queue will be sent before the packet at the front of the
        /// wind queue).
        ///
        /// This function is only called from a synchronous loop in the
        /// UDPServer so we don't need to bother making this thread safe
        /// </remarks>
        ///
        /// <returns>True if any packets were sent, otherwise false</returns>
        public bool DequeueOutgoing()
        {
            OutgoingPacket packet;

            OpenSim.Framework.LocklessQueue <OutgoingPacket> queue;
            TokenBucket bucket;
            bool        packetSent = false;
            ThrottleOutPacketTypeFlags emptyCategories = 0;

            //string queueDebugOutput = String.Empty; // Serious debug business

            for (int i = 0; i < THROTTLE_CATEGORY_COUNT; i++)
            {
                bucket = m_throttleCategories[i];
                //queueDebugOutput += m_packetOutboxes[i].Count + " ";  // Serious debug business

                if (m_nextPackets[i] != null)
                {
                    // This bucket was empty the last time we tried to send a packet,
                    // leaving a dequeued packet still waiting to be sent out. Try to
                    // send it again
                    OutgoingPacket nextPacket = m_nextPackets[i];
                    if (bucket.RemoveTokens(nextPacket.Buffer.DataLength))
                    {
                        // Send the packet
                        m_udpServer.SendPacketFinal(nextPacket);
                        m_nextPackets[i] = null;
                        packetSent       = true;
                    }
                }
                else
                {
                    // No dequeued packet waiting to be sent, try to pull one off
                    // this queue
                    queue = m_packetOutboxes[i];
                    if (queue.Dequeue(out packet))
                    {
                        // A packet was pulled off the queue. See if we have
                        // enough tokens in the bucket to send it out
                        if (bucket.RemoveTokens(packet.Buffer.DataLength))
                        {
                            // Send the packet
                            m_udpServer.SendPacketFinal(packet);
                            packetSent = true;
                        }
                        else
                        {
                            // Save the dequeued packet for the next iteration
                            m_nextPackets[i] = packet;
                        }

                        // If the queue is empty after this dequeue, fire the queue
                        // empty callback now so it has a chance to fill before we
                        // get back here
                        if (queue.Count == 0)
                        {
                            emptyCategories |= CategoryToFlag(i);
                        }
                    }
                    else
                    {
                        // No packets in this queue. Fire the queue empty callback
                        // if it has not been called recently
                        emptyCategories |= CategoryToFlag(i);
                    }
                }
            }

            if (emptyCategories != 0)
            {
                BeginFireQueueEmpty(emptyCategories);
            }

            //m_log.Info("[LLUDPCLIENT]: Queues: " + queueDebugOutput); // Serious debug business
            return(packetSent);
        }
